Home Hardware Networking Programmazione Software Domanda Sistemi
Conoscenza del computer >> software >> Compressione dei dati >> .

Perché avviene la compressione?

La compressione dei dati funziona identificando e rimuovendo le informazioni ridondanti in un flusso di dati. Quando i dati vengono compressi, modelli e sequenze ridondanti vengono sostituiti con codici più brevi, riducendo la dimensione complessiva dei dati senza comprometterne il contenuto o la qualità. Questo processo di rimozione delle informazioni ridondanti consente di rappresentare i dati originali in una forma più efficiente e compatta.

Ecco una spiegazione semplificata di come funziona la compressione dei dati:

1. Identificazione della ridondanza :Il primo passo prevede l'analisi dei dati per identificare modelli ridondanti o elementi ripetitivi. Queste ridondanze possono verificarsi a vari livelli, ad esempio all'interno di singoli caratteri, sequenze di caratteri o blocchi di dati più grandi.

2. Codifica :Una volta identificati gli elementi ridondanti, vengono sostituiti con codici o simboli più brevi. Questi codici servono come rappresentazioni per i dati ridondanti, consentendone la memorizzazione in modo più condensato. Vari algoritmi di compressione utilizzano metodi di codifica diversi per ottenere una compressione ottimale.

3. Decodifica :Quando è necessario accedere o utilizzare i dati compressi, vengono sottoposti al processo inverso di decodifica. I codici o simboli utilizzati durante la compressione vengono interpretati e riportati alla loro forma originale, ricostruendo i dati originali.

4. Compressione senza perdite e con perdite :Esistono due tipi principali di tecniche di compressione dei dati:compressione senza perdita e compressione con perdita. La compressione senza perdita preserva tutti i dati originali senza alcuna alterazione, quindi i dati decompressi sono identici all'originale. D'altra parte, la compressione con perdita introduce una piccola quantità di distorsione per ottenere rapporti di compressione più elevati. Questa distorsione è spesso impercettibile o irrilevante per alcuni tipi di dati, come immagini o audio.

In sostanza, la compressione dei dati mira a eliminare ripetizioni non necessarie e inefficienze nella rappresentazione dei dati, consentendo di archiviare più informazioni in uno spazio più piccolo senza comprometterne significativamente l'accuratezza o l'utilità.

 

software © www.354353.com